Once again the Andean culture shows its ingenuity and surprises the world, an example of the Andean ingenuity is the construction of the Inca bridge "Q´eswachaka" that currently gives communication to 2 towns separated by the Apurimac river. The Inca bridge of "Q´eswachaka" is located in the province of Canas, 3 hours from the city of Cusco

The material used for the construction of the Inca bridge of "Q´eswachaka" is ichu, a type of grass from the high Andean areas, the annual replacement is carried out in the month of June of each year by the inhabitants of the high communities. Andean from Ccolla, Qqewe, Huinchiri and Perccaro. The change is made in 4 days and during this change Andean rituals and typical festivities of the area are practiced. This hanging Inca bridge is made of vegetable fiber (Ichu) and is located on the Apurímac River in the Quehue district. • The existence of this bridge dates back to Inca times. The maintenance and renovation is done once a year by local people from the surrounding communities. Before beginning with the renovation of the bridge, an offering is given as a sign of respect and gratitude to Pachamama. We will have the opportunity to cross the Inca bridge from both sides.
